    Abstract: Detecting single molecules includes binding the single molecules to a surface of an optically transparent substrate, irradiating the surface of the substrate with light having an incident angle selected to achieve total reflection of the light, thereby scattering light from the surface and from the single molecules bound to the surface, and collecting light scatted by the surface and by the single molecules bound to the surface to form a series of images. Systems for detecting single molecules include an optically transparent substrate, a means for flowing a sample solution over a surface of the substrate, a light source configured to irradiate the surface, a camera, and a collection optical system configured to collect light scatted by the surface and by the target molecules on the surface to form a series of images on the camera.

    Abstract: Provided herein are methods of detecting unlabeled biomolecules. In some embodiments, the methods include disrupting a cell population sufficient to release unlabeled biomolecules from the cell population to produce released biomolecules in which the cell population is disposed on a first inner surface of a chamber that is disposed substantially within a fluidic device and in which the chamber comprises a fluidic material. In some embodiments, the methods also include binding the released biomolecules to a second inner surface of the chamber to produce surface-bound biomolecules, introducing an incident light toward the second inner surface of the chamber concurrent with, and/or after, producing the surface-bound biomolecules, and detecting light scattered by the surface-bound biomolecules over a duration to produce a set of biomolecule imaging data. Related fluidic devices, systems, and computer readable media are also provided.
